Posted at 1:41 AM ET following the Wildwood, NJ rally, this post is likely aide-drafted campaign content deployed during the acute stress period of the Senate impeachment trial. Its manifest content conspicuously avoids the week's dominant events — the Bolton manuscript leak, the Yovanovitch recording, ongoing Senate defense arguments — redirecting entirely to 2020 electoral mobilization. This redirection functions as a large-scale defense: rather than process narcissistic injury from the trial, the subject's public communication projects outward toward campaign identity reinforcement. The 'drain the swamp' invocation during impeachment constitutes implicit DARVO — the accused performs the role of anti-corruption crusader. Rhetorically the post is above Trump's baseline stylistic register, deploying a conditional-imperative syllogism and invoking military sacrifice as moral collateral for electoral participation. Psychologically, the post is maintenance-mode supply-seeking operating against an anxious background of legal jeopardy. No rage, no dehumanization, no danger indicators. The grandiose narrative — that electoral victory is coextensive with civilizational salvation — is consistent with baseline patterns and represents no significant deviation. Authorship attribution is mixed: timing is authentic (post-rally, late night) but prose quality and campaign URL suggest Scavino drafting.
